二级目录 wordpress 伪静态
时间 : 2024-01-03 22:29:03声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

最佳答案

WordPress是一个非常常见的内容管理系统(CMS),它允许用户轻松建立和管理自己的网站或博客。与其他CMS不同的是,WordPress具有众多的插件和主题,使得用户可以根据自己的需求和喜好来定制和设计自己的网站。而WordPress的伪静态功能则是其中一个非常重要的特性,它可以提升网站的性能和SEO优化。

所谓伪静态,是指将动态生成的页面URL转换为静态的URL形式,从而使得搜索引擎和用户更容易识别和理解这些页面。伪静态的页面URL一般不包含动态参数,而是采用与页面内容相关的静态关键字来命名,例如:/category/wordpress/page/2/。相比动态URL,伪静态URL更加友好和易读,对于搜索引擎爬虫和用户来说更加直观和易于理解。

在WordPress中启用伪静态功能需要通过.htaccess文件进行配置。首先,确保你的Web服务器支持Rewrite Module(如Apache服务器),然后在WordPress的设置中选择"永久链接"选项,将链接结构设置为自定义,选择一个合适的伪静态链接格式。一般来说,常用的伪静态链接格式有以下几种:

1. 带有文章标题的链接格式:/%category%/%postname%/

这种方式将文章分类和文章标题都包含在URL中,例如:/category/wordpress/wordpress-伪静态/。

2. 带有文章ID的链接格式:/%year%/%monthnum%/%post_id%/

这种方式将文章发布的年份、月份和文章ID都包含在URL中,例如:/2021/11/123/。

3. 带有日期的链接格式:/%year%/%monthnum%/%day%/

这种方式将文章发布的年份、月份和日期都包含在URL中,例如:/2021/11/16/。

无论选择哪种伪静态链接格式,都需要在.htaccess文件中添加相应的规则来实现URL重写。.htaccess文件一般位于WordPress安装目录的根目录下,你可以通过FTP或者文件管理器访问并编辑该文件。以下是一种常见的.htaccess规则配置示例:

<IfModule mod_rewrite.c>

RewriteEngine On

RewriteBase /

RewriteRule ^index\.php$ - [L]

RewriteCond %{REQUEST_FILENAME} !-f

RewriteCond %{REQUEST_FILENAME} !-d

RewriteRule . /index.php [L]

</IfModule>

请将上述代码复制到.htaccess文件的最后一行,并保存文件。然后刷新你的WordPress网站,伪静态功能就会生效了。

启用伪静态功能后,你会发现WordPress的页面链接都会变成伪静态URL格式了。这不仅可以提升用户体验,使得网站链接更加美观和易于记忆,还有助于搜索引擎的索引和排名。搜索引擎更喜欢静态的URL格式,并且会更多地收录和展示这些URL,从而提升网站的曝光度和流量。

总结一下,WordPress的伪静态功能是一种能够提升网站性能和SEO优化的重要特性。通过配置.htaccess文件以及选择合适的伪静态链接格式,你可以很容易地启用和使用这一功能。不仅可以提升用户体验和搜索引擎的索引,还能使你的WordPress网站更具专业性和可读性。

其他答案

WordPress是一个常见的开源内容管理系统(CMS),它允许用户创建和管理自己的网站或博客。默认情况下,WordPress生成的网址是动态的,即每次访问时都会根据数据库中的内容动态生成网页。然而,有些用户希望将其网址转换为伪静态,以获得更好的搜索引擎优化(SEO)和用户友好性。

伪静态是指在URL中模拟静态页面的网址,实际上仍然是动态生成的页面。通过将参数化的动态URL转换为更简洁、易于理解和记忆的静态URL,伪静态可以改善网站在搜索引擎中的排名,提高用户体验。

要在WordPress中启用伪静态功能,需要进行以下步骤:

第一步,确保你的主机环境支持伪静态。通常,大多数共享主机和虚拟主机都支持伪静态。如果你是自己的服务器,则需要在服务器配置中启用伪静态。

第二步,登录WordPress的后台管理界面,点击左侧菜单中的“设置”选项,然后选择“常规”子菜单。在“常规设置”页面的“permalink”选项下,选择你想要的网址结构。默认的设置是动态的,你可以选择包括文章名称、分类、标签等。

第三步,更新设置后,WordPress会自动生成一个伪静态的网址结构。如果你的主机环境不支持伪静态,你可能会遇到404错误页面或其他问题。在这种情况下,你需要联系你的主机提供商或服务器管理员,以获取支持和解决方案。

第四步,更新伪静态设置后,你的WordPress网站的URL将会变为伪静态格式,并且对外部访问者也会显示为伪静态URL。这将有助于搜索引擎对你的网站进行索引和排名,并使用户更容易记住和分享你的网址。

总结来说,伪静态是通过将动态生成的URL转换为更友好和可读性更强的静态格式,从而改善WordPress网站的搜索引擎优化和用户体验。启用伪静态功能需要确保主机环境支持,并在WordPress后台设置中进行相应的更改。